Mike Tannebaum's Jets prediction makes you wonder how he ever became a GM in the first place
A Get Up segment by former NFL general manager Mike Tannenbaum just created a hypothetical NFL locker room so chaotic it hurts to think about.
A Get Up segment by former NFL general manager Mike Tannenbaum just created a hypothetical NFL locker room so chaotic it hurts to think about.